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8688832 41338 97243580714 15 55866
12 916671987 346470003
12 916671987 346470003
689836609 843475564 18 3556333108
All about undefined
Interested in learning more?
12 916671987 346470003
689836609 843475564 18 3556333108
See more
376 57 968
8862835993 25763576982 286 58
See more
17 0117
5487055 07243 22
See more